Output 32d205fdb4ae99016a8c914de293e7c7c8a64e0513115099d9af31c6f7abde09:17

value
392447
script pubkey
OP_0 OP_PUSHBYTES_20 a15e1ac7f50fbb267b4e3972936e5a6b0878b057
address
bc1q590p43l4p7ajv76w89efxmj6dvy83vzh8fttjv
transaction
32d205fdb4ae99016a8c914de293e7c7c8a64e0513115099d9af31c6f7abde09
spent
true